Evaluate the Reputation of the Company
Before hiring a Security Guard Service, it is crucial to check the company’s reputation. Look for reviews, testimonials, and feedback from past clients. A company with a strong track record is more likely to provide professional and reliable services. Additionally, consider how long the company has been in the business. Experience often translates to better training and understanding of security needs.
Check Licensing and Certifications
A professional security company must have proper licenses and certifications. These documents show that the company complies with local regulations and standards. Hiring an unlicensed company can create legal risks for your business. Ensure the security guards have undergone background checks and are trained in safety protocols. Certifications in first aid and emergency response are an added advantage.
Assess Training and Experience of Guards
The training level of security personnel is a major factor. Guards should be trained in handling emergencies, crowd management, and conflict resolution. Experience in different security environments, such as corporate offices, retail, or residential areas, is essential. Well-trained guards are more alert and prepared to prevent potential risks effectively.
Understand the Services Offered
Security companies offer different services, and it is vital to understand what is included. Some provide only on-site guards, while others include patrol services, surveillance monitoring, and emergency response. Choosing a company that aligns with your specific needs ensures better security coverage. Clarify the terms in the contract to avoid misunderstandings.
Consider the Technology They Use
Modern security often requires the integration of technology. CCTV cameras, alarm systems, and real-time monitoring improve the efficiency of guards. Ask if the company uses technology to support their personnel. Combining trained guards with technology enhances overall safety and minimizes risks.
Review Pricing and Contracts
Cost is an important factor, but it should not be the only one. Evaluate the pricing structure and compare it with the services provided. Avoid companies with unusually low rates, as this may indicate poor quality. Ensure the contract is transparent and includes details about responsibilities, schedules, and terms of service.
Availability and Response Time
A good security company should offer flexible schedules and quick response times. Emergencies can happen at any moment, so guards must be ready to act. Discuss response protocols and ensure they can meet your business’s specific needs. This ensures that your property is protected around the clock.
Insurance and Liability Coverage
Security work involves inherent risks. Confirm that the company provides adequate insurance coverage. Liability insurance protects your business in case of accidents or damages caused by security personnel. This is a critical factor that safeguards you from unexpected costs.

Communication and Coordination
Effective communication between your staff and the security team is vital. Guards should be able to report incidents clearly and follow instructions promptly. A company that emphasizes coordination will handle threats more efficiently. It also helps build trust and confidence in their services.
